Output aa51a7d707930adea6b786af50e9b6eb7538cdb61f94fb9a3df4e22800f88910:0

value
953865048
script pubkey
OP_0 OP_PUSHBYTES_20 aadb58703572ebabb4f36384c6c7021bc7dda8e1
address
bc1q4td4sup4wt46hd8nvwzvd3czr0ram28pwwxkvq
transaction
aa51a7d707930adea6b786af50e9b6eb7538cdb61f94fb9a3df4e22800f88910
spent
true